PGX Technology Overview:
- Ceapro’s PGX technology is a disruptive approach that involves using pressurized gas to expand bio-based materials. It has the potential to revolutionize drug and bioactive delivery systems.
- The technology can transform various natural polymers, including yeast beta glucan and alginate.
-
PGX Yeast Beta Glucan (PGX-YBG):
- Ceapro successfully demonstrated the use of PGX-YBG as a delivery system for Coenzyme Q10 (CoQ10).
- CoQ10 is notoriously poorly bioavailable when taken orally. However, PGX-YBG significantly improved its delivery into tissues compared to the current gold standard.
- This breakthrough could lead to the creation of novel nutraceutical and pharmaceutical products.
-
PGX Alginate (PGX-ALG):
- PGX-ALG is derived from sodium alginate, extracted from brown seaweed.
- It also has broad applications in both nutraceuticals and pharmaceuticals.
